I'm not trying to derail the thread, but not all MMORPG's are "grind-fest, cookie-cutter train-rides". There are a few diamonds in the rough. I can recommend Darkfall Online (although not as amazing as it was at launch, great pvp), Shadowbane (amazing gvg), and Ultima Online (wonderful rp'ing). A buddy of mine who "specializes" in MMO's swears by Asheron's Call as well; although now it's quite dated.
